Ingredients
- Fruits: 1 cup strawberries (hulled, large berries sliced for heart shapes), 1 cup seedless watermelon (cut into 1/2-inch slices), 1 cup cantaloupe (cut into 1/2-inch slices), 1 cup honeydew melon (cut into 1/2-inch slices), 1 cup blueberries, 1 cup seedless grapes (red or green)
- Optional Garnish: 2 tbsp fresh mint leaves (for serving)
Instructions
- Step 1:
- Using a small heart-shaped cookie cutter, cut heart shapes from the watermelon, cantaloupe, and honeydew melon slices.
- Step 2:
- Slice large strawberries in half lengthwise, then trim the tops into a heart shape using a paring knife if desired.
- Step 3:
- Thread fruit onto skewers, alternating berries, grapes, and heart-shaped melon pieces for a colorful pattern.
- Step 4:
- Arrange the finished skewers on a serving platter.
- Step 5:
- Garnish with fresh mint leaves and serve immediately, or cover and refrigerate for up to 2 hours before serving.

Notes
For a chocolate twist, drizzle skewers lightly with melted dark chocolate before serving. Pair with vanilla yogurt or chocolate dip for extra fun.
Required Tools
Small heart-shaped cookie cutter, paring knife, cutting board, skewers (8 10 inches)
Allergen Information
Contains no common allergens. Check for cross-contamination if using pre-cut or packaged fruits.
